School Overview
Pioneer Valley Performing Arts Charter Public School (PVPA) is a specialized public charter school located in South Hadley, Massachusetts, that integrates rigorous academic study with an intensive focus on the performing and visual arts. Serving students in grades 7 through 12, the school is designed for those who wish to pursue a college-preparatory education while immersing themselves in disciplines such as theater, dance, music, and media arts. PVPA operates on the philosophy that artistic expression is a vital component of intellectual development, encouraging students to develop both their creative voices and their critical thinking skills.

The school is well-regarded for its collaborative and inclusive community, where students are expected to engage deeply in both their academic classrooms and their artistic studios. By providing professional-level instruction in the arts alongside a standard high school curriculum, PVPA prepares its graduates for a wide array of post-secondary paths, ranging from top-tier performing arts conservatories to traditional four-year universities. Through its unique mission, PVPA offers a distinctive educational environment for students across the Pioneer Valley who are passionate about the arts and dedicated to academic achievement.
